Re: At this age, I think exercise might kill me if I start.

And `well done` from me. It`s already been said-start slowly,no `high impact` training. Yoga yes,pilates yes,swimming yes-aerobics when most are in their 20s? No.

In the gym-again start just walking on the treadmill. Use weights by all means and set the weight quite high(do NOT forget to breath)-15-20 reps using a heavier weight does more good than endless reps with a low tension.

Re: At this age, I think exercise might kill me if I start.

Take it slow and work up, it'll come.

You should work out a small route from your house to walk.

I did this, the first time I walked it, it took me thirty eight minutes. A couple of months later I was doing it in eighteen minutes and looked like a speed walker.

With in three months I was up to four and half miles a day on a larger route.

The stamina I built up was incredible. Walking is one of the best ways of exorcising and losing weight in my opinion.
